Russian silver denga of Ivan IV The Terrible as grand prince 1533-1547, obverse:- PRINCE / GRAND / IVAN in three lines of cyrillic script, reverse:- Ivan on horseback galloping right brandishing sword, W = abbreviation for OSPODAR = sovereign?, between horse's legs, usual eliptical flan, rare, GVF
Seljuks of Rum Ghiyath Al Din Kay, Khusru II, 634-643 AH, silver Dirhem, Konya Mint, AH 638 = 1241-1242 A.D., obverse:- Inscription around, sun above, lion right, reverse:- Inscription in five lines, see Broome/Novak no. 242A [Sun in Leo, his wife's birthsign], lovely gold and blue peripheral tone, well centred, EF
